Job Summary:
Interventional Radiology Technologist in Madison, Wisconsin. This position involves working collaboratively with vascular interventional physicians and nurses, utilizing multiple imaging modalities including fluoroscopy, ultrasound, computed tomography, and magnetic resonance imaging for diagnostic and interventional procedures. The role requires imaging inpatient, outpatient, pediatric, and intra-operative patients with a focus on critical thinking and technical proficiency.

Job Details:

  • Shift Schedule: Days, 8-hour shifts, start times between 7 AM and 10 AM, Monday through Friday. Travelers will be assigned 4x10-hour shifts during holiday weeks. No weekends or holidays. Possible standby, if needed.
  • Required Qualifications: Graduated from a School of Radiologic Technology, State of Wisconsin Licensed Radiographer, ARRT (R) certification, BLS (American Heart Association) certification, minimum of 2 years clinical interventional imaging experience.
  • Certifications: ARRT (R), ARRT (VI), BLS (AHA), Wisconsin Radiographer license.
  • Skills: Accessing/Managing Ports, Central Venous Access (non-tunneled/PICC lines), Central Venous Lines - Care and Maintenance, Chest Tube Placement, Computed Tomography, Embolization, Equipment Setup, Fluoroscopy, Gastrostomy Tube Placement, Inferior Vena Cava (IVC) filter removal, IVC imaging, Interventional Radiology procedures, PPE/Isolation Precautions, PACS, Paracentesis, PICC Lines Care, Sterile Technique, Thoracentesis, TIPS, Ultrasound.
  • Experience: Two years of acute care experience in interventional imaging or relevant specialty preferred. Experience with inpatient, outpatient, trauma, and neuro (stroke) patient populations preferred.
  • Additional Information: Candidates must pass strict Pass/Fail telemetry testing, which includes identification of lethal rhythms, with specific passing scores required on both adult and pediatric exams. Testing attempts are limited to three, with submission of a cardiac interpretation review course certificate required after initial failures.

About

Madison is the capital of Wisconsin, located about an hour west of Milwaukee. Frequently listed as one of the best places to live in the United States, this city ranks high in economy, diversity and education. Madison is a young and vibrant Midwestern town and is the home of the University of Wisconsin Madison, a top-ranked public institution. Visitors can’t miss the iconic Wisconsin State Capitol Building, a beautiful historic building located on a strip of land between Lakes Mendota and Monona, or the Olbrich Botanical Gardens, open year-round and boasting over 16 gardens. To really get a feel for this lively city, take a stroll down State Street, with seven blocks of bustling restaurants, beach access and street art.
